About Birchgrove 2041

The size of Birchgrove is approximately 0.6 square kilometres. It has 10 parks covering nearly 24.8% of total area. The population of Birchgrove in 2016 was 3303 people. By 2021 the population was 3228 showing a population decline of 2.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Birchgrove is 50-59 years. Households in Birchgrove are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Birchgrove work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 70.80% of the homes in Birchgrove were owner-occupied compared with 68.40% in 2016.

Birchgrove has 1,685 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Birchgrove have seen a 51.05%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 41.11% increase. As at 31 December 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Birchgrove is $3,576,225 while the median value for Units is $1,685,384.
  • Houses have a median rent of $1,100 while Units have a median rent of $850.
